Digitasi, also spelled digitisasi, is the process of converting information from analog forms into digital representations. In practice, digitasi enables data to be stored, processed, indexed, searched, transmitted, and preserved using electronic systems. The term is widely used in Indonesian contexts, where it denotes the broader practice of making information accessible in digital formats.
